Amendment C028 (Moorabool)

Rezone former Bacchus Marsh Treatment Plant, Avenue of Honour, Bacchus Marsh, Certificate of Title Volume 10208, Folio 507, described as Lot 1 on Plan of Subdivision 335977F from Public Use Zone 1 (Service and Utility) to Rural Zone, amend the Schedule to the Rural Zone to include the subject land within Map 1, apply the Design & Development Overlay Schedule 2 to the land and remove the Environmental Audit Overlay from the land.

How to object or make a submission

Your next step if this rezoning affects you. Submissions are how the decision-maker hears from the community.

  1. 1 Rezonings happen through planning scheme amendments under the Planning and Environment Act 1987. The council exhibits the amendment and invites submissions.
  2. 2 Make a written submission to the council during the exhibition period, stating whether you support or oppose the amendment and why.
  3. 3 If unresolved submissions remain, they are referred to an independent planning panel, where submitters can be heard before the council decides.
